Summary
Forest Fuel Utilization Act of 1979 - Authorizes the Secretary of Agriculture to make grants through the rural forestry assistance program of the Forest Service to States for the employment of additional State foresters or equivalent State officials. Requires the Secretary to determine the number of woodlot owners in each State. Authorizes the Secretary to make forest fuel utilization training programs available to State foresters, or equivalent State officials, in States in which forest growth is underutilized and in which there is a potential for the utilization of wood as a fuel in place of oil. Directs: (1) the Secretary of Energy to develop a plan to increase the assistance and information provided to the Forest Service by the Department of Energy; and (2) the Administrator of the Small Business Administration to develop a plan to increase the managerial assistance and information provided to small woodlot owners and wood fuel distributors and marketers by the Small Business Administration.
